JIH Gen. Sec. strongly condemns terror attacks in Peshawar and Nairobi

September 24, 2013

jihpress
New Delhi, September 24: Mr. Nusrat Ali, General Secretary, Jamaat-e-Islami Hind has strongly condemned the ghastly terror attacks in Peshawar and Nairobi which claimed around two hundred human lives.

“We strongly condemn the terror attacks in Peshawar of Pakistan and Nairobi of Kenya on Sunday in which around two hundred innocent people were killed,” said Mr. Ali in a media statement on Tuesday. He categorically said these attacks are being planned and executed to malign the image of Islam. “Whoever has executed these blasts must be condemned. It seems such attacks are being engineered to malign the image of Islam in the world,” said JIH General Secretary.

While stressing that violence should not be given any place in a civilized society JIH leader said complaints if any should be addressed through dialogue and peaceful means. “Violence has no place in a civilized society. If any group or community has any grievances or complaints against the governments and authorities they should resolve such complaints through dialogue and peaceful and democratic means,” said JIH leader.
